uPVC windows
Windows are an important part of your home. Windows let in light, air, noise pollution reduction, and also keep the drafts out. upvc windows repair near me can also be visually pleasing and increase the curb appeal of your home.
Window frames are made from aluminium, wood or uPVC. However, uPVC frames are most preferred for homes. It is durable and resistant to rust and therefore you can be at ease knowing that your window will last a long time.
These windows are also very energy efficient. They can help you save money on heating bills, and you may even be eligible for a Green Homes Grant.
In contrast to glass panes, which allow cold or heat to pass through windows, uPVC windows are not able to have gaps. They are well-insulated to keep your home cool in summer and warm in winter.
You can choose from a variety of different uPVC window styles, including single-hung, double-hung and casement windows. They are available in a variety of different colors and designs. They are also easy to keep clean. You can wipe them with a damp cloth to remove any dirt or grime that has accumulated.
Your windows' uPVC profile is extremely weatherproof, which means they won't get rotten or corroded even in harsh environments. This is particularly true of coastal regions where salt corrosion can cause severe damage to frames made of metal.
Moreover, uPVC frames are less expensive than timber and aluminium frames. They also have a high degree of insulation which helps lower heating costs.
If you are thinking of buying new uPVC windows for your home, it is crucial to look at the window Energy Rating of your new windows. These ratings are available online and can assist you to pick the windows that are most energy efficient.
A high Energy Rating will save you lots of money on electric and heating bills. Keep in mind that a significant portion of the heat in your home escapes through the windows of your home, and it is important to replace them with energy efficient ones.
UPVC windows are very popular in the UK. They are inexpensive, energy efficient, low-maintenance and come in a variety of styles and colours. They can also be as appealing as wooden windows, and are as efficient in insulating.
Double glazing with misty reflections
Double glazing is a fantastic investment in any home. It provides greater warmth, blocks out noise, and increases energy efficiency. It's an easy concept two glass panes separated by a layer of gas (argon, xenon or Krypton) to create an insulating layer and hold heat inside.
But, if the seal between the glass panes is damaged, it could let water into your window and result in condensation. This isn't just ugly however, it's also a sign that your windows aren't functioning as they should.
It's important to fix misty windows before winter arrives. Otherwise, moisture will build up in your home and cause your heating system to work harder. Replacement of broken double glazed units will save you money on your energy bills in the long run and also reduce your carbon footprint.
You can attempt to deal with this issue by wiping away any excess water on the exterior of your windows, but if that isn't enough, it's time to seek assistance from a professional glazier. They can repair or replace any windows that have been damaged to make sure they're ready for whatever weather can throw at them.
Condensation can happen in any structure, but it is more prevalent in new homes because of the freshness of the materials and more absorbent. It's a natural part of the process but it can be difficult to control, particularly in the case of a lot of doors or windows throughout your property.
No matter where your misty windows are located It is essential to have them fixed before winter gets here to make them more energy efficient. Furthermore, the misty look of your window can make it less attractive to look at and could make it harder for you to rest at night in your home.

Glass that is cracked
Cracked glass is a regular issue in glassware, picture frames, mirrors and door glass, in addition to numerous other household items. If the glass is exposed to moisture dust and temperature fluctuations small cracks may turn into large cracks.
Some glass can be repaired, while other glass needs to be replaced. It doesn't matter how severe the damage is, it's important that you know how to fix broken glass in the best way possible.
The first step is to identify the type of crack you have. The most popular type of crack is called stress cracks. They usually appear as small creases at the edge of a window pane. As time passes, they may spread across the entire window, rendering it difficult to repair.
Cracks can be caused by temperature fluctuations, or by the constant force applied to the window through closing it. They also happen when windows aren't properly installed.
Two-part epoxy is a great method to repair damaged glass. It can be purchased in a double-cylinder Syringe. It contains a resin and hardener that must be mixed before use.
You'll then have to press the epoxy into the crack. The epoxy will cure in about five minutes and you should be patient. Once it has been cured, you'll need to take out the excess epoxy and allow it to dry.
After the crack has healed, you will have to clean the repaired area using glass cleaner. To remove the excess epoxy off the surface, employ an acetone-soaked cloth.
Another option to repair your glass is to use Bostik's Fix & Glue super glue, which is solvent-free, clear and odourless. This glue can be applied to a variety of materials, including metal, wood, plastic, glass, and many other materials.
There are also super glue gels that are thicker and offer "non-drip" properties. These gels are a fantastic solution for fixing thin cracks in glass because they permit glue to move down the cracks more easily, creating stronger bonds.
